Opening the doorThe door must remain closed while the stove is alight, otherwise it could damage the inside of the stove. The doormust be opened slowly, holding it slightly ajar for a moment before opening it completely. Open the door whenthe flame has died down and certainly never when the flame is very intense and always use the gloveprovided.Ensure that the self-closing door does not bang shut, as this could break the glass.ATTENTION: THE GLOVE IS NOT DESIGNED FOR PICKING UP BURNING EMBERS!!!It is not dangerous if smoke comes out while the stove is stoked; just open the window for a while.ReloadingThe chimney flue is equipped with a fire plate, structured for loading only one layer of wood.CAUTION: DO NOT OVERLOAD THE WOOD STOVE. EXCEEDING THE QUANTITIES INDICATED BELOW, NOT ONLYDOES THE EFFICIENCY AND THE EMISSION OF POLLUTANTS VARY, BUT THE WOOD STOVE CAN OVERHEATCAUSING DAMAGE TO THE BUILDING AS WELL. THEREFORE, OBSERVE THE DESIGN LOAD QUANTITIES.1. Add wood logs every 45/60 minutes.2. When loading the wood, do not suddenly open the door otherwise exhaust gas can leak out, always usethe glove provided.3. Distribute the embers uniformly on the cast iron fire plate and add max 2 – 3 wood logs (for quantity seeTabelle 1: Quantity of fuel).4. Utilize only dry wood, use neither wastes nor multi-ply woods.5. Once the flame has developed, close the door.Overnight o<strong>per</strong>ationIf wind and draught conditions are reasonably stable, and a rather hard wood is used, the stove will continue toburn through the night.Last thing at night check that the bed of embers is low but still alight and add fuel before closing the door, ensurewood is well alight for 10-15 minutes before reducing the air intake control. (Picture 3)O<strong>per</strong>ation during intermediate seasonsDuring the intermediate seasons, when the outdoor tem<strong>per</strong>atures are higher, a sudden rise can cause amalfunction of the draft impeding pro<strong>per</strong> smoke exhaust. In this case the stove must be loaded with little wood,covering the primary air control, so that the fuel burns faster(generating the flame) and thus stabilizes the draft. To avoid the creation of counterflow in the ember bed, the ashmust be stoked more frequently and with caution.Disposal of the ashesThe ashpan must be emptied regularly, so as to prevent the build up of ashes to the level of the fire grill, as thiscould damage it.The ashes must be placed in a container with a close-fitting lid. This container must be put on a non-combustiblesurface or on the ground and well away from combustible materials until it is certain that all the ashes are definitelyextinguished.ATTENTION: ASH KEEPS THE EMBERS ALIGHT FOR A LONG WHILE!!!With drop-latch models (SL) when reloading use the drop-latch opening only (or raise and lower the glass)and not the door opening.52
